It could be fleas, bed bugs, mosquitoes, carpet beetle larvae, or something else. If it's fleas you will more often get bites on your feet and ankles. If it's bed bugs, bites may not always itch or be in a line, and you will continue to get them if they are in your home. Carpet beetle larvae done bite but they cause skin to itch and react in the same way as bites. Really requires close inspection of the environment rather than inspection of the bites.
